Coventry Bears Beaten By The Thunder

Last updated : 25 June 2016 By CNS Sport

Coventry Bears Rugby League team were beaten 14-32 by Newcastle Thunder at the Butts Park Arena this afternoon.

Cov took the lead when Grant Beecham dived over but in the 17th minute, Fox went over to get Newcastle level.

Seven minutes later and Charlie O'Mara went over with James converting. However, Newcastle ran in a 28th minute try to equalise again.

Eddie Medforth dived on a 31st minute kick through with Newcastle also scoring to see Cov down by two points at half-time.

Newcastle added another try in the 43rd minute before the rain came down.

With the Bears down to eleven players after Jay Lobwein was yellow carded with Beddows already off, Newcastle used their numerical advantage to run in another try with thirteen minutes left ran in another try to send The Bears to a 14-32 defeat.
